Electronics Technician - Pharmacy Automated Equipment Systems
U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s is seeking an Electronics Technician located in the VA Medical Center in Tucson, AZ. The role involves providing comprehensive support for automated pharmacy equipment systems, including troubleshooting, maintenance, and programming of various electronic systems.

Responsibilities
Providing technical support of systems including preventive maintenance - installation - evaluation - troubleshooting - repair - calibration - testing - and modification
Fully comprehends and trains staff on the complex interrelations between the major components and subsystems
Responsible for installation and programming the logic ladder software within the programmable logic controllers (PLC's) utilizing a personal computer
Responsible for reprogramming PLC's as necessary to improve traffic performance of the conveyor system and optimizes individual machine PLC's by modifying the existing software by resetting timers and logic in the multiple layers of the ladder program
Responsible for troubleshooting - repair - replace and reprogramming old or poorly functioning PLC's
Responsible for assisting in programming laser scanners and decoders on the conveyor system utilizing a personal computer - PLC's or other host computers
Responsible for the maintenance and repair of the robotics used in the production systems
Serves as the primary service technician for physical security and related equipment
Performing other duties as assigned
Qualification
Required
Work as a technician - instructor - inspector - or mechanic (civilian or military) that showed progression in theoretical and practical knowledge of electronic theory - and of the characteristics - function - operation - and capabilities of a variety of types of electronic equipment
Experience must have included the use of schematic diagrams - a variety of test equipment - and the application of appropriate electronic formulas involved in such duties as testing - troubleshooting - modifying - designing - calibrating - installing - maintaining - repairing - constructing - developing and instructing on electronic equipment - or similar functions
Experience in developing policies - standards - and procedures for maintenance - installation - or similar functions - provided the work clearly shows that the applicant applied a specialized knowledge of the theories and principles of a variety of electronic systems or equipment
Providing comprehensive technical support for automated equipment systems such as automatic packaging systems - tote conveyor systems - and automated medication counting systems
Providing comprehensive technical support for subsystems such as controllers - sensors - bar code scanners - industrial controls and equipment - pulse and counting mechanisms - monitors - and data terminals
Performing preventative maintenance - installation - evaluation - troubleshooting - repair - calibration - testing and modification of systems
Installation and programming the logic ladder software within the programmable logic controllers (PLC's) utilizing a personal computer
Must have successfully completed two and a half (2 1/2) years of graduate education that is directly related to the work of the Electronics Technician - position such as electrical engineering - electronics engineering - or electronics technology
One year of full-time graduate education is considered to be the number of credit hours that the school attended has determined to represent 1 year of full-time study
Part-time graduate education is creditable in accordance with its relationship to a year of full-time study at the school attended
Possess equivalent combinations of specialized experience and graduate education as described that demonstrates the ability to perform the duties of this position
You will be rated on the following Competencies as part of the assessment questionnaire for this position: Communication Mechanics Planning and Evaluating
Requires working in unusual positions while assembling and disassembling equipment and tedious bench work while working on electronic assembles
The work performed is of a precise nature requiring prolonged concentration - and mental demands are high
The incumbent must be able to interact effectively with all levels of CMOP staff and must remain calm and analytical even under stress
Lifting and moving of devices weighing up to 50 pounds on a regular basis is required
